    Kelvin Hughes Australian integration partnership with AMS goes from strength to strength

    Kelvin Hughes is attending PACIFIC 2017 showing its commitment to supporting its integration partners in Australasia - AMS Defence and AMS Maritime (both subsidiaries of the AMS Group – AMSG), who together will provide world class radar technology, service and support to The Royal Australian Navy on their current and potentially future program’s such as the Future Frigate Program, Offshore Patrol Vessel Program and Collins Class upgrades, the company said in its press release.
     
    The biennial Pacific International Maritime Exposition, will be held in Sydney from Tuesday 3rd to Thursday 5th October 2017. As the only comprehensive international exhibition of its kind in the Indo-Asia-Pacific region, PACIFIC 2017 provides the essential showcase for commercial maritime and naval defence industries to promote their capabilities in the region.
     
    Kelvin Hughes with its solid state Doppler SharpEye™ radar systems and AMS Defence with it’s unsurpassed in-country installation, support and service network, will work together to focus on the next generation of Australian maritime programmes including ANZAC Class support, the various sustainment programmes and also submarine technology upgrades with the Kelvin Hughes SharpEye™ Doppler radar downmast variant.
     
    Cooperation expertise also extends to the coastal and port surveillance projects in Australia which span Vessel Traffic Service (VTS) systems for commercial and industrial ports and also to the various coastal surveillance agencies. Kelvin Hughes with the key support of AMS Defence have already been hugely successful in the region with Kelvin Hughes providing SharpEye™ to the ANZAC Class Frigates previously and AMS Defence recently providing the in-service support.
     
    AMS Maritime has integrated numerous radars in diverse locations for coastal surveillance and port applications such as Onslow LNG terminal, Port of Darwin VTS and Port of Dampier VTS and most recently commenced works on Port Hedland the world’s largest bulk export port. Typically, AMS Maritime provide the integrated VTS package and Kelvin Hughes provides the radar sensor – SharpEye™.
     
    SharpEye™ is a solid state radar sensor that employs a unique package of radar techniques including Doppler processing, enhanced pulse compression and Moving Target Detection (MTD) to bring a range of user benefits which includes operation in high clutter environments whereby the clutter is removed in the sensor itself through internal clutter filters, yet outputs the radar targets of interest to the radar processor leaving a clear easy to manage situationally aware picture for the operator to view. SharpEye™’s USP is the detection of low Radar Cross Section (RCS) targets in severe weather conditions, earlier.
     
    These sensor capability benefits when applied to shipborne navigation and situational awareness systems and land based radar installations provides unprecedented surveillance capabilities to the end customer.
     
    ABOUT KELVIN HUGHES
     
    Kelvin Hughes Ltd is a world leader in the development, manufacture and supply of maritime navigation, surveillance and security radar systems. The company sets the international standard in solid state radar sensor technology with SharpEye™ and its market leading tactical and situational awareness radar display software.
     
    Headquartered in Enfield, North London, UK, Kelvin Hughes operates a worldwide support network with offices in 5 countries (UK, US, Singapore, Denmark and The Netherlands) that meet customer requirements 24/7.
